MUMBAI, India, Nov. 28 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202411025976 A) filed by Chandigarh University; and Chandigarh University Technology Business Incubator, Mohali, Punjab, on March 29, 2024, for 'surface cable/ pipe protecting device.'
Inventor(s) include Avinash Kumar Pandey.
The application for the patent was published on Nov. 28, under issue no. 48/2025.
According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"A surface cable/ pipe protecting device comprises a hump-shaped structure 1 developed positioned on a ground surface laid with cables and pipelines, multiple suction cups for affixing the structure 1 with the surface, an artificial imaging unit 2 to detect dimensions and exact location of the cables/ pipes, a pair of motorized slider 3 for adjusting position of multiple plates 4 for making an ample amount of gapping in between the plates 4 as required for accommodating the cables/ pipes underneath the structure 1, a proximity sensor for monitoring presence of any vehicle in proximity to the structure 1, and multiple motorized two axis-lead screws 5 for translating a damper 6, a PIR (Passive Infrared Sensor) for detecting presence of rodents/ reptiles in proximity to the structure 1, and an ultrasonic emitter to emit high frequency ultrasonic waves for deterring the / rodent/ reptile away from the structure 1."
